The NFL Network's Tom Pelissero reported on Tuesday (March 28) that the Philadelphia Eagles had a request approved, allowing players to wear a jersey with the number 0.
Pelissero shared a photo of the updated rule presented at the 2023 NFL Owner's conference. Any player, except for OL & DL, can wear the No. 0 jersey & also confirmed that this includes punters & placekickers.

Clement was the first Pit player to don the no. 0 from '46 to '48. He played in 25 games & completed 86/228 passes for 1,630 yds & 11 scores. He also returned kicks & punts, & ran 239 times for 991 yards & 7 TDs.

Johnny O, one of the first NFL players to don jersey no. 0, played for the Cards, Redskins & Lions. He was chosen to compete in the Pro Bowl twice. In '62, he retired from AFL after playing for the Broncos.

The last player to don the no. 0 was Logan, who played as a safety for 2 yrs with the Cowboys & later joined the Saints in '67. After the Saints released him, the Cowboys re-signed him but cut him. He died in 2003.
